Paving works in Ordnance Street, Valletta, have been completed but Infrastructure Minister Joe Mizzi this morning could not say when the monti open market will move there from Merchants' Street.
The preparations for the move were being made by another ministry, he said, but the move would be made when all works on the City Gate project were completed. Infrastructure Minister Joe Mizzi said that his ministry had collaborated with the Economy Ministry to prepare uniform stalls.
The new paving consists of lava and hardstone. The project, costing €350,000, included the laying of new utility services. The Infrastructure Ministry last July ordered a contractor to re-lay the paving in Ordinance Street after the required standards were not reached.
Mr Mizzi said his ministry will also be restoring the Tritons and Wignacourt fountains and Wignacourt Tower. Paving works will be carried out in Triq Mikiel Anton Vassalli, Triq it-Teżorerija and Strada Stretta.
